Loparex LLC is the world's largest manufacturer of extrusion base and silicone-coated release liners for the converting industry. We have facilities throughout the U.S., Europe, China, and India. Loparex's Iowa City Facility is currently looking for a Controls Engineer to join our team.

As a Controls Engineer, the individual will be responsible for machine control programming, data acquisition and HMI for the Iowa City facility.

PRIMARY J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BLITIES

  • Promotes safety by leading by example, participating in safety engagements, and encouraging the team to work safely each day and to follow all safety guidelines and procedures

  • Abiding by all plant safety rules (lockout/tagout, confined space entry, fall protection, etc.)

  • Determines and writes programs for PLC, HMI and AC/DC drives

  • Design, install and modify new and existing electrical and electronic equipment

  • Supervise start up and implementation of new or modified equipment

  • Develops systems to maintain the facility consistent with plant goals and continuous operations

  • Responsible for understanding NED electrical codes, OSHA regulations and standard operating procedures for installing, modifying, and repairing electrical and electronic equipment and systems

  • Create and revise schematic drawings using AutoCAD to document architecture of automated systems and field wiring

  • Modifications to existing PLC programs to enhance productivity, making changes within ladder logic, function block programing and visual basic coding

  • Ownership of Proficy IFix computers, hardware & software upgrades, problems, changes, etc.

  • Participate in the BBS (Behavioral Based Safety) and LPA (Layered Process Audit) programs

  • Projects for AEI (Automation, Electrical & Instrumentation) solutions

  • Participation on plant safety committees as needed

  • On-site attendance

  • Other duties as assigned by manager

JOB SKILLS, EXPERIENCE, AND KNOWLEDGE REQUIREMENTS

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ent combination of education and experience

  • Previous experience to meet job expectations, preferably in a manufacturing environment

  • Experience with Intellution, Ihistorian, Allen Bradley, Siemens TI 505 and Ladder Logic programming

  • Ability and skill to use a wide variety of diagnostic and repair tools

  • Ability to read and follow electronic/electrical schematics, technical manuals, drawings, and regulatory

  • Working knowledge of industrial electrical concepts and process instrumentation

  • Strong analytical and communication skills, including ability to lead a team

  • Ability to prioritize and plan work activities, use time efficiently and develop realistic action plans.

  • Ability to communicate professionally, both verbally and in writing

  • Solid computer skills with office productivity software for email, word processing and spreadsheets
